Increasing
Tenant Self-management:
Canada's
First Conversion from
Public
Housing to Co-operative Housing
Tuesday,
February 10th, 2004
9am
to 4:30 pm

You
are invited to hear about the experiences of a public housing community
converting into co-operative housing. The conference involves a
discussion in converting public housing to co-operative housing.
|
On April 1st, 2003, the Atkinson
Housing Co-operative became the first Canadian public housing project to
convert into a co-operative.
Come hear the key people behind this conversion share their story of
how the Atkinson Co-operative was created:

Discussion will include:
|
Steps to increasing tenant participation
|
|
How to convert into a housing co-operative
|
|
Issues and challenges encountered by each stakeholder
